However, since editing is my life, I'd like to give you some constructive (read: encouraging!) criticism.
One thing people keep mentioning are the cliffhangers; they actually have me a bit perturbed. Honestly, everything I've read so far could have been part of one chapter. It's jarring to read it this way, all disjointed... When you're reading a good story, you don't want to be interrupted. I wouldn't actually call the method you're employing "cliffhangers" so much as "speed bumps." Personally, I'm getting tired of being jostled around! My point is, once you've got us in the action, keep us there. There's no reason to chop your story up this much. I would create some transitions between these chapters and join them together.
